Champions League: “Arteta insulted my family”, indignant Porto coach Sergio Conceiçao

What really happened at the end of the meeting between Arsenal and FC Porto this Tuesday, in the round of 16 second leg of the Champions League? Beaten 1-0 in the first leg three weeks ago in Portugal, the London club finally qualified, at the end of the suspense, by winning the penalty shootout (4-2) after winning 1- 0 at the end of 120 minutes of play.

At a press conference, FC Porto coach Sergio Conceiçao accused Mikel Arteta, his Arsenal counterpart, of having insulted his family during this round of 16 second leg of C1. “During the match he (Arteta) turned to the bench and insulted my family in Spanish,” Conceicao told reporters. At the end of the match, I called out Arteta because the person he insulted is no longer with us. »

Asked about the incident in the post-match press conference, Arteta replied: “No comment.” His team will know its opponent for the quarter-finals of the Champions League this Friday during the draw (first leg on April 9 or 10, return on April 16 or 17).
